Snippet

This paper reports terabit Nyquist-wavelength division multiplexing (Nyquist-WDM) superchannel transmission using five subcarriers. Each sub-carrier is 222 Gb/s polarization multiplexed-16 quadrature amplitude modulation (PM-16QAM) advance modulation format …
